Solutions to common technical problems of the Panasonic Lumix FZ2500

The Panasonic Lumix FZ2500 is a compact camera that combines powerful zoom with advanced features, making it ideal for both professional and amateur photographers. However, like any technological product, problems can sometimes arise. In this article, we will explore solutions to common technical issues encountered by users of the Panasonic Lumix FZ2500.

1. Autofocus issues on the Panasonic Lumix FZ2500

Solution: Check the focus settings

The Panasonic Lumix FZ2500 is equipped with fast and accurate contrast-detection autofocus. However, problems may occur when lighting conditions are low or when the lens is obstructed. Ensure that the focus is correctly set on the camera. Use manual focus mode if necessary, especially for low-light shots.

Solution: Clean the lens

A dirty lens can lead to autofocus issues. It is advisable to regularly clean the lens with a soft cloth and check that no dust or dirt is obstructing the autofocus.

2. Firmware update issues

Solution: Update the FZ2500 firmware

The Panasonic Lumix FZ2500 benefits from regular firmware updates. These updates are important for fixing bugs and improving the camera's performance. To perform an update, visit the official Panasonic website and follow the instructions specific to your model.

Solution: Reset the device

If the firmware update does not resolve the issue, try resetting the camera's settings. This can often fix minor software malfunctions. You will find the reset option in the settings menu.

3. Battery issues of the Panasonic Lumix FZ2500

Solution: Check the battery status

The Panasonic Lumix FZ2500 uses a Li-ion battery. If you notice a significant decrease in battery life, it may be aging. Replace it with a new compatible battery to regain optimal performance.

Solution: Avoid complete discharge

To extend the battery life, avoid letting it discharge completely. Charge it when the level reaches about 20 to 30% to maintain its long-term capacity.

4. Wi-Fi connectivity issues

Solution: Check your network connection

The Panasonic Lumix FZ2500 offers a Wi-Fi feature that allows you to easily transfer your photos. If you are having difficulty connecting the device to your Wi-Fi network, make sure your router is functioning properly and that the device is in an area with a stable Wi-Fi signal.

Solution: Restart the device

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ve Wi-Fi connection issues. Turn off the device, wait a few seconds, then turn it back on to try to restore the connection.

5. 4K video recording issues

Solution: Check recording settings

The Panasonic Lumix FZ2500 allows 4K video recording, but some users may encounter difficulties. Make sure you have selected the correct recording format in the device menu and that your memory card is fast enough to support 4K video files.

Solution: Use a fast memory card

To record 4K videos without issues, it is recommended to use a Class 10 or faster SDHC or SDXC memory card. A slow memory card can cause interruptions during recording.
